Biography
With six years of experience as an NFL linebacker, Calvin Pace has been no stranger to success. After spending five seasons with the Arizona Cardinals, who drafted the Wake Forrest standout in the first round of the 2003 NFL Draft, Pace signed a six-year contract with the New York Jets in 2008. Throughout his career, Calvin has amassed impressive statistics with 21 sacks, two forced fumbles and fumble recoveries, one interception, and over 260 tackles. During the 2008 season alone, the Detroit native compiled 80 tackles and seven sacks. Pace attended Lithia Springs High School in Lithia Springs, Georgia, and later enrolled at Wake Forrest University. It was here that Calvin became one of the nation’s top NFL prospects and twice received All-ACC honors. In addition to making big plays on the football field, Pace also does what he can to give back to the community. For the upcoming 2009 season, Calvin has teamed up with the Touchdown Shutdown Program to benefit After-School All-Stars and cannot wait to make a difference in the lives of as many kids as possible.
